39 #ifndef __MONO_METADATA_W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_H__
40 #define	__MONO_METADATA_W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_H__
41 
42 #include <glib.h>
43 
44 struct stat;
45 typedef struct {
46 	int gl_pathc;		/* Count of total paths so far. */
47 	int gl_offs;		/* Reserved at beginning of gl_pathv. */
48 	int gl_flags;		/* Copy of flags parameter to glob. */
49 	char **gl_pathv;	/* List of paths matching pattern. */
50 } mono_w32file_unix_glob_t;
51 
52 #define W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_APPEND	0x0001	/* Append to output from previous call. */
53 #define W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_UNIQUE	0x0040	/* When appending only add items that aren't already in the list */
54 #define	W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_NOSPACE	(-1)	/* Malloc call failed. */
55 #define	W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_ABORTED	(-2)	/* Unignored error. */
56 #define	W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_NOMATCH	(-3)	/* No match and W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_NOCHECK not set. */
57 #define	W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_NOSYS	(-4)	/* Function not supported. */
58 
59 #define	W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_MAGCHAR	0x0100	/* Pattern had globbing characters. */
60 #define W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_LIMIT	0x2000	/* Limit pattern match output to ARG_MAX */
61 #define W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_IGNORECASE 0x4000	/* Ignore case when matching */
62 #define W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_ABEND	W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_ABORTED /* backward compatibility */
63 
64 G_BEGIN_DECLS
65 
66 int
67 mono_w32file_unix_glob (GDir *dir, const char *, int, mono_w32file_unix_glob_t *);
68 
69 void
70 mono_w32file_unix_globfree (mono_w32file_unix_glob_t *);
71 
72 G_END_DECLS
73 
74 #endif /* !__MONO_METADATA_W32FILE_UNIX_GLOB_H__ */
